期刊文献+
共找到3篇文章
< 1 >
每页显示 20 50 100
分布式计算中基于资源分级的自适应Min-Min算法 被引量:4
1
作者 巩子杰 张亚平 张铭栋 《计算机应用研究》 CSCD 北大核心 2016年第3期716-719,725,共5页
Min-Min任务调度算法的思路总是优先调度执行时间较短的小任务,无法得到理想的最优跨度及资源负载平衡。针对该问题,提出基于资源分级的自适应Min-Min算法。分配任务前,先参考现有资源的属性进行分级处理,再与任务在资源中的最小完成时... Min-Min任务调度算法的思路总是优先调度执行时间较短的小任务,无法得到理想的最优跨度及资源负载平衡。针对该问题,提出基于资源分级的自适应Min-Min算法。分配任务前,先参考现有资源的属性进行分级处理,再与任务在资源中的最小完成时间作乘积得到的最小任务资源组合进行调度;在任务调度过程中,引入自适应阈值,调节长任务的调度等级,从而达到优化效果。通过模拟仿真实验,表明该算法在时间跨度和负载平衡上均有较好性能。 展开更多
关键词 分布式计算 任务调度 MIN-MIN算法 资源分级 负载平衡
在线阅读 下载PDF
异构Flink集群中负载均衡算法研究与实现 被引量:9
2
作者 汪志峰 赵宇海 王国仁 《南京大学学报(自然科学版)》 CAS CSCD 北大核心 2021年第1期110-120,共11页
Flink是目前非常流行的流处理引擎.和先前的Hadoop,Spark,Storm等分布式计算框架相比,Flink能实现低延迟、高吞吐,保证Exactly Once.调度模块是保证集群高性能非常重要的一部分,但目前Flink调度默认把集群中所有节点看作是同等性能的,... Flink是目前非常流行的流处理引擎.和先前的Hadoop,Spark,Storm等分布式计算框架相比,Flink能实现低延迟、高吞吐,保证Exactly Once.调度模块是保证集群高性能非常重要的一部分,但目前Flink调度默认把集群中所有节点看作是同等性能的,采用轮询调度策略.但在异构集群里这样的调度就会低效,因为计算资源少的节点运行的Task和计算资源多的节点运行的Task一样多,所以局部负载不均衡,影响Job的运行时间和吞吐量,造成延时.提出平滑加权轮询任务调度算法和基于蚁群算法的任务调度算法,解决运行过程中集群负载不均衡问题.平滑加权轮询任务调度算法在任务调度初始阶段根据集群资源按照权重平滑轮询调度.基于蚁群算法的任务调度算法是在运行过程中当集群已使用资源高于阈值时采用类似蚁群算法去执行任务调度,动态计算全局最优任务分配方案,能重新负载均衡. 展开更多
关键词 APACHE Flink 任务调度 负载均衡 平滑加权轮询任务调度 基于蚁群算法的任务调度
在线阅读 下载PDF
面向Flink的负载均衡任务调度算法的研究与实现 被引量:10
3
作者 李文佳 史岚 +1 位作者 季航旭 罗意彭 《计算机工程与科学》 CSCD 北大核心 2022年第7期1141-1151,共11页
Apache Flink是现在主流的大数据分布式计算引擎之一,其中任务调度问题是分布式计算系统中的关键问题。由于集群的异构性以及不同算子复杂度不同,大数据计算系统Flink中不可避免地会出现负载不均的情况,针对这种问题,提出了基于资源反... Apache Flink是现在主流的大数据分布式计算引擎之一,其中任务调度问题是分布式计算系统中的关键问题。由于集群的异构性以及不同算子复杂度不同,大数据计算系统Flink中不可避免地会出现负载不均的情况,针对这种问题,提出了基于资源反馈的负载均衡任务调度算法RFTS。通过实时资源监控、区域划分和基于人工萤火虫优化的任务调度算法3个模块,把负载过重的机器中处于等待状态的任务分配给负载较轻的机器,来实现集群的负载均衡,提高系统集群利用率和执行效率。最后通过基于TPC-C和TPC-H数据集的实验结果表明,RFTS算法从执行时间和吞吐量2个方面有效提升了Apache Flink计算系统的性能。 展开更多
关键词 Apache Flink 基于资源反馈的负载均衡任务调度算法 实时资源监控 区域划分 人工萤火虫优化算法
在线阅读 下载PDF
上一页 1 下一页 到第
使用帮助 返回顶部